Seeking to tap into forum members deepwater drilling knowledge and related experiences in regards to metocean specific related drilling problems and effects  (stating key factor, area, water depth) and  'lost time' that resulted.

Example: A deepwater well drilled a few years ago off West Africa had no current modelling and no data for the region prior to rig arrival. To cut a long story short shallow high currents were experienced (2-4knots) that persisted to add an estimated 45-60days on to the wells AFE due to the non identified hazard/risks presented.

The intent of this discussion therefore is to attempt to gather a more global deepwater metocean drilling perspective for an article being written. Metocean Areas of key interest being:

Typhoon cyclone areas?
Solitons experienced (where, duration? what was extent of loss time)
Poor seabed visibility (reason for this, outcome)
High Currents (what depths, were these associated with tidal effects etc)
Winds/waves
Combined effect.
